What's The Definition Of Swish?
swish
verb: If something swishes or if you swish it, it moves quickly through the air, making a soft sound. swish in American English adjective intransitive verb: to move with or make a sibilant sound, as a slender rod cutting sharply through the air or as small waves washing on the shore noun: a swishing movement or sound transitive verb: to flourish, whisk, etc., with a swishing movement or sound swish in British English adjective: fashionable; smart noun: a hissing or rustling sound or movement verb: to move with or make or cause to move with or make a whistling or hissing sound |
